quantum leap
ˌquantum ˈleap (also ˌquantum ˈjump) noun [countable]
a very large and important development or improvement
    quantum leap in
    There has been a quantum leap in the range of the wines sold in the UK.
    The treatment of breast cancer has taken a quantum leap forward.
